The Project Manager I on the Strategic Analytics team oversees large-scale projects, coordinating across Sales, Operations, and Analytics to ensure smooth execution from bid tracking through completion. This role demands strong ownership and accountability, proactively identifying patterns, risks, and opportunities to improve processes, performance, and customer experience.

Primary Responsibilities

  • Manage setup, execution, and ongoing tracking of large account and mega project initiatives, ensuring milestones, deliverables, and financial goals are met.
  • Maintain ownership of individual project performance while also monitoring trends across all active projects to identify recurring challenges, systemic issues, and opportunities for process improvement; proactively drive cross-functional solutions to enhance overall execution and customer outcomes.
  • Partner with analysts to interpret project financials, tying performance to profitability and identifying opportunities for improvement.
  • Maintain an accurate and current pipeline of project bids, partnering with sales team members to stay up to date on opportunities, bid status, and customer needs.
  • Utilize project management software to track project timelines, deliverables, budgets, and performance metrics, ensuring full visibility for stakeholders.
  • Develop and maintain detailed project status reports, dashboards, and documentation to keep leadership and teams informed of progress, risks, and next steps.
  •  Coordinate and lead cross-functional project meetings, preparing agendas, capturing action items, and driving accountability to completion.
  •  Proactively identify risks, bottlenecks, or communication gaps that could impact project success, and work with stakeholders to craft and execute solutions.
  •  Serve as a liaison between sales teams, operations, and leadership to ensure consistent project execution and customer satisfaction.
  • Serve as a project manager for the Strategic Analytics team, coordinating initiatives across business segments to ensure alignment, timely execution, and effective communication between analytics, operations, and leadership.
  •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ives, refining tools, processes, and workflows that enhance transparency, efficiency, and customer engagement.
